I hunt WMAs in mississippi. You have to purchase a WMA permit to hunt them. Its about $15 and you get it where you purchase your regular license. Some WMAs do have draw hunts but usually they are in addition to a regular season. It is very important you read the rules and regulations for each WMA you plan to hunt. They are very strict and each are different. Each Wma has a link on MDWFP.
